Cutting Funeral Costs

The simplest, least expensive arrangements for care of a deceased person’s body are direct cremation and immediate burial. All funeral homes and mortuaries must offer both of these options and must list them on their General Price List (GPL). Prices vary greatly from funeral home to funeral home.

DIRECT CREMATION is a simple cremation without embalming, viewing, or any kind of service. The price is low because the Funeral Director may arrange the cremation at a time that is convenient for them. For more details on shopping for a Direct Cremation package, CLICK HERE. 

IMMEDIATE BURIAL is a basic burial package that does not include embalming, viewing, or any kind of service. The price is low because the Funeral Director may arrange for transporting the casketed body to the cemetery at a time that is convenient for them. Usually the family is not even present at the burial. Since there is no viewing or ceremony, the casket can be plain and simple and there is no need for cosmetology of the body.  For more details on shopping for an Immediate Burial package, CLICK HERE. 

OTHER OPTIONS: Even those who opt for something more traditionally full-featured than Immediate Burial or Direct Cremation can still experience significant cost savings by understanding their rights and choices, shopping around, and asking the right questions. Knowing what you want and what you don’t want is the first step. Doing your research—on this site and elsewhere—to get an understanding of the range of possibilities is the second. Then shop around!
